What are typical scheduling practices for hourly employees?

Hourly employees often have schedules that can vary week by week, with shifts set by management based on business needs, peak hours, or employee availability. Many employers post schedules in advance, but flexibility may be required to cover additional shifts or respond to last-minute changes. Overtime opportunities can sometimes be available during busy periods, and part-time or full-time hours may be offered. Understanding your employer's scheduling policies will help you manage your time and balance work with personal commitments.

What is an hourly job?

An hourly job is a position where employees are paid based on the number of hours they work, rather than receiving a fixed salary. Hourly workers typically track their time and may be eligible for overtime pay if they exceed a certain number of hours per week, depending on labor laws. These jobs are common in industries like retail, hospitality, and manufacturing. Hourly employees may have flexible schedules but often lack the benefits that come with salaried positions.

Job description

Job Duties

Assists general manager and assistant manager to supervise crew member and team leaders to maintain a good level of customer service and ensure orders are taken in a prompt, accurate and courteous manner. Hourly Managers resolve customer complaints as needed. Opens restaurant, sets up cash drawers, initiates computer run and makes final deposit of previous night's receipts. Turns on fryers, broilers and breakfast grills. Prepares food and waits on customers at counter and drive-thru window. Prepares garnish for lunch sandwiches, cuts lettuce, tomatoes, pickles and onions. Receives and stores incoming shipments of food. Rotates stock in freezer/cooler. May do minor repairs. Operates cash register. May close restaurant, cleaning kitchen equipment, and dining room, preparing final deposit and closing paperwork. Hourly Managers help build a positive and motivating environment for all employees that is committed to delivering superior customer service.

This job description is a generic listing of the responsibilities of the Hourly Manager position; some of these responsibilities may not be required at all times.

Equipment, Tools, Materials Utilized: Food and preparation equipment, computer, report paperwork, automobile.

Work Environment: Indoors, heat from cooking equipment. Outdoors for some cleaning and maintenance of the patio, parking lot and other outdoor spaces.

Physical Requirements:

Type / Frequency / Description, Heights and Weight

  • Sitting / Occasional / At breaks and lunch/dinner
  • Standing / Constant / Surface: Tile
  • Reaching / Frequent / Floor to 6-7 feet
  • Twisting / Occasional / May twist at waist or turn entire body
  • Bending / Occasional / May usually bend or squat to reach floor
  • Squatting / Occasional / May usually squat or bend to reach floor
  • Climbing / Only closers / Surface: Step or fixed ladder, Height: 6ft
  • Pushing/Pulling / Occasional / Bread racks or equipment on roller
  • Carrying / Occasional / Weight: Mostly under 10 Lb., occasionally upto 50 Lb. Distance: Within restaurant
  • Lifting / Occasional / Height: to waist: Weight: Most under 10Lb., but occasionally up to 50 Lb.
